Introduction
AMLOBLAZE AT is a prescription medicine containing Amlodipine 5 mg and Atenolol 50 mg, a scientifically established combination of a calcium channel blocker and a cardioselective beta-blocker. This dual-action therapy is widely prescribed for the management of hypertension (high blood pressure) and chronic stable angina, particularly in patients who require more than one antihypertensive agent to achieve optimal blood pressure control.
The two active ingredients in AMLOBLAZE AT work through complementary mechanisms. Amlodipine relaxes and widens blood vessels, improving blood flow and reducing peripheral vascular resistance, while Atenolol decreases heart rate and myocardial contractility, reducing cardiac workload and oxygen demand. Together, they provide effective blood pressure reduction and improved cardiovascular protection.
Long-term control of hypertension with medicines such as AMLOBLAZE AT, when combined with healthy lifestyle modifications, has been shown to reduce the risk of cardiovascular complications including stroke, myocardial infarction, heart failure, and kidney disease associated with persistently elevated blood pressure.

How AMLOBLAZE AT Works
AMLOBLAZE AT works through the complementary actions of its two active ingredients.
Amlodipine is a long-acting dihydropyridine calcium channel blocker that inhibits calcium influx into vascular smooth muscle cells. This causes relaxation of arterial blood vessels, reduces peripheral vascular resistance, and lowers blood pressure while improving blood flow.
Atenolol is a selective beta₁-adrenergic receptor blocker that slows the heart rate, reduces the force of cardiac contraction, and decreases cardiac output. These effects reduce myocardial oxygen demand and help control blood pressure while improving symptoms of chronic stable angina.
By combining these two mechanisms, AMLOBLAZE AT provides effective blood pressure reduction while reducing cardiac workload. This combination contributes to improved cardiovascular outcomes when used as part of a comprehensive treatment plan that includes lifestyle modification and regular medical follow-up.
